Abstract Title: Global Trends and Age-Specific Patterns of Thyroid Cancer Subtypes (2000–2020): A Systematic Review, Meta-analysis and Forecasting Study

Biography:

Talha Bin Tariq is a fifth-year medical student at the College of Medicine, Sulaiman Al Rajhi University, Saudi Arabia. His academic interests include endocrinology, oncology, internal medicine and cardiology, with a strong focus on clinical epidemiology & systematic reviews and meta-analyses. He also has a growing interest in the application of artificial intelligence in medical research, particularly in disease prediction, trend analysis and clinical decision support. His research aims to integrate data-driven approaches to improve evidence-based clinical practice and public health planning.
